Mac 上的 JavaFX WebView 字体问题

标签 java macos javafx

一些网站显示乱码而不是正确的文本。它只发生在 Mac 上。

以 GMapsFX 为例: enter image description here

Online site : enter image description here

可能与 OS X 10.11 或 10.12 有关。我用 Java 1.8.0_121 测试了它。

这个问题有任何修复或解决方法吗?

最佳答案

就我而言,该错误与系统字体无关。我通过为网络引擎设置用户代理解决了这个问题。这是我使用的字符串(Windows x64 上的 Firefox):

Mozilla/5.0 (Windows NT x.y; Win64; x64; rv:10.0) Gecko/20100101 Firefox/10.0

关于Mac 上的 JavaFX WebView 字体问题,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/41952734/

相关文章:

linux - *nix 配置文件存储约定?

从构建的 JRT 模块运行应用程序时,从 URL 构造的 JavaFX 11 javafx.scene.image 抛出 SSLHandshakeException

java,从多个图像合成图像

java - 在 ServletContext 资源 [/WEB-INF/spring-security.xml] 中定义了名称为 'offlineTokenServices' 的无效 bean 定义

java - 如何创建动态二维数组并在其中存储打乱数组

java - 为什么当我选择一首新歌时我的音乐没有停止?

macos - Mac 上的 cp --parents 选项

java - Solr 无法在使用 Azul JVM 的 MacOS M1 上启动

objective-c - 在运行时更改 Cocoa 应用程序图标、标题和菜单标签

JavaFX 检查 Node 属性是否正在被监听